Smart Beginnings expects record attendance for early learning symposium
The Early Learning Symposium will offer five hours of high quality training for area professionals working with young children. A core strategy of Smart Beginnings is to advance the quality of care provided for children birth to age 5. The Symposium contributes significantly to that goal by making professional development for early care providers locally accessible and affordable.
Kimberly P. Johnson, children's author and storyteller, will provide the opening keynote address, "Charting a Bolder Course." A former Head Start student, Ms. Johnson holds a Bachelor's degree in Communications from UNC, a Master's degree in Youth Development and Leadership from Clemson University, and has authored 16 children's books. Other sessions will include Teaching Children of Poverty, the Best Circle Time Ever, Playing Out: Space for Play, the Fun Fab Five Senses of Language Development and the Infant and Toddler Zone.
